Description

This form is a cast member contract between an actor and a producer for a television series. The contract provides that the actor will perform at the sole option of the producer. The program will consist of live, improvisational, ensemble, comedic performances and comedic sketches, performed and recorded live by an ensemble cast before a live audience.

To make amendments to your limited liability company in Wyoming, you provide the completed Limited Liability Company Amendment to Articles of Organization form in duplicate to the Secretary of State by mail or in person, along with the filing fee.

Benefits of an LLC in Wyoming. There are significant benefits to forming an LLC in Wyoming such as unparalleled limited liability protection, fewer corporate formalities, no state income taxes, and privacy. Member and/or Manager names are never required on public record for an LLC in Wyoming.

You can form a Wyoming LLC even if you don't live in Wyoming. Residency in the state, or the USA, is not required to form a company. A majority of LLCs are formed by non-residents. Forming an LLC in Wyoming as a non-resident is the same process as for a resident.

Wyoming has no income taxes on companies or people. Wyoming has close LLC's which do not require annual meetings, so there is less paperwork.
